Output 51cfd60b1dea5d8f8f23c78fa2dc7398b88bfecf634db6a45b9948ecfaadb2b5:107

value
25344
script pubkey
OP_0 OP_PUSHBYTES_32 dc4ceae2e3403b12ea00ede16ee95e72b5ffafbb0bc3a4f147fbd69df62569ef
address
bc1qm3xw4chrgqa396sqahska627w26lltamp0p6fu28l0tfma39d8hsu3tekn
transaction
51cfd60b1dea5d8f8f23c78fa2dc7398b88bfecf634db6a45b9948ecfaadb2b5